Transaction

98701e77b74da4089c53ae65c97034b4d678222dc0dc7eb8aaa0ed2962fcdcf2

Summary

In Block668657
TimeFri, 02 Jun 2017 05:24:31 UTC
Total Input2546.17353691 PIV
Total Output2550.66891469 PIV
Fees0 PIV

Details

Fee: 0 PIV
3990141 Confirmations2550.66891469 PIV
Raw Transaction